¥詳詢
廣州嵌入式LINUX班
課程描述: |
企業(yè)*需要的是什么樣的人才?那無疑是具有項(xiàng)目實(shí)戰(zhàn)的實(shí)踐能力。本linux培訓(xùn)課程采用理論教學(xué)與項(xiàng)目實(shí)踐相結(jié)合的方式,系統(tǒng)地介紹了嵌入式Linux下環(huán)境和應(yīng)用程序開發(fā)技術(shù)。Linux培訓(xùn)內(nèi)容強(qiáng)化了Linux開發(fā)環(huán)境、Linux操作系統(tǒng)的基本原理、C和C 基礎(chǔ)的基本能力,在此基礎(chǔ)上能夠獨(dú)立勝任嵌入式Linux應(yīng)用開發(fā),滿足企業(yè)對(duì)嵌入式軟件開發(fā)工程師需求。 Linux 應(yīng)用開發(fā)班是基于LINUX的軟硬件培訓(xùn)體系結(jié)構(gòu),全日制脫產(chǎn)5個(gè)月,共600個(gè)學(xué)時(shí),以實(shí)質(zhì)性項(xiàng)目實(shí)踐為導(dǎo)向,掌握*實(shí)用、*先進(jìn)的開發(fā)技能和項(xiàng)目實(shí)戰(zhàn)經(jīng)驗(yàn)。相當(dāng)于在企業(yè)2年研發(fā)經(jīng)驗(yàn)。**高薪,不退款,簽訂高薪**。 |
課程目的: |
**本課程的系統(tǒng)學(xué)習(xí),學(xué)員對(duì)桌面和嵌入式linux應(yīng)用編程有了全面的了解,具備編寫linux環(huán)境下的應(yīng)用程序和模塊能力,能夠掌握: 1、掌握嵌入式Linux的環(huán)境搭建過程; 2、掌握Linux下進(jìn)程、網(wǎng)絡(luò)、GUI、數(shù)據(jù)庫的開發(fā)方法,為產(chǎn)品開發(fā)打下堅(jiān)實(shí)的基礎(chǔ); 3、精通Linux操作系統(tǒng)具體操作; 4、精通嵌入式Linux系統(tǒng)開發(fā)的整體流程; 5、熟悉嵌入式Linux進(jìn)程及進(jìn)程間通信; 6、熟練編寫Linux應(yīng)用程序,包括網(wǎng)絡(luò)、圖形、數(shù)據(jù)庫等。 |
: | 消費(fèi)類電子(手機(jī)、PDA、游戲機(jī))、數(shù)字 多媒體(網(wǎng)絡(luò)點(diǎn)播、機(jī)頂盒)、汽車電子(導(dǎo)航儀)、醫(yī)療電子、工業(yè)控制等行業(yè)。 |
培訓(xùn)對(duì)象: | 計(jì)算機(jī)、電子、自動(dòng)化、通信、信息工程等相關(guān)專業(yè)。文科專業(yè),原則上可申請(qǐng)入學(xué),入學(xué)前需要具備C語言基礎(chǔ) |
入學(xué)要求: | C語言基礎(chǔ)、C 基礎(chǔ)、數(shù)據(jù)結(jié)構(gòu)、操作系統(tǒng)原理 |
授課講師: | 陰雷鳴 馮寶祥 劉志剛 張老師 鄧人銘 |
**認(rèn)證: | GCSDE認(rèn)證 ARM-ATC認(rèn)證 |
預(yù)科(彈性時(shí)間)(免費(fèi))
課時(shí) |
詳細(xì)內(nèi)容 |
大綱條目 |
課時(shí) 累計(jì) |
|
彈性時(shí)間 |
5至10天 |
Linux C編程前奏,典型C程序?qū)嵗庞[ 核心數(shù)據(jù)類型,可移植性數(shù)據(jù)類型 |
標(biāo)準(zhǔn)C語言 |
0天 (免費(fèi)) |
字符串和格式化IO 運(yùn)算符,表達(dá)式和語句 |
||||
控制流,字符IO和輸入確認(rèn) |
||||
函數(shù),字符串和字符函數(shù) |
||||
數(shù)組與指針(1) |
||||
數(shù)組與指針(2) |
||||
存儲(chǔ)類,鏈接和內(nèi)存管理 LINUX C內(nèi)存映像 |
||||
結(jié)構(gòu)體,聯(lián)合和枚舉,復(fù)雜聲明 |
||||
高級(jí)議題(預(yù)處理指令、地址對(duì)齊、回調(diào)函數(shù)等) |
||||
3天 |
JAVA基本語法,類的基本概念 |
JAVA編程 |
||
類和對(duì)象,類的繼承 |
||||
函數(shù)重載和運(yùn)算符重載 |
||||
1天 |
階段考核 |
筆試、閉卷 |
|
**期(18天)
課時(shí) |
詳細(xì)內(nèi)容 |
大綱條目 |
課時(shí)累計(jì) |
5天 |
LINUX系統(tǒng)簡介,安裝和APT軟件管理器使用 |
LINUX系統(tǒng) |
5天 |
SHELL核心命令 |
|||
LINUX系統(tǒng)結(jié)構(gòu)及常用命令 |
|||
LINUX網(wǎng)絡(luò)配置及交叉開發(fā)環(huán)境搭建 |
|||
5天 |
C編程環(huán)境搭建:GCC,GDB,make等工具使用 |
LINUX-C編程核心技術(shù) |
10天 |
指針與數(shù)組,函數(shù)調(diào)用等核心技術(shù) |
|||
GNU擴(kuò)展語法等高級(jí)議題 |
|||
5天 |
單雙向鏈表,循環(huán)鏈表,LINUX內(nèi)核鏈表 |
精品數(shù)據(jù)結(jié)構(gòu)(C實(shí)現(xiàn)) |
15天 |
特殊線性表,棧與隊(duì)列 |
|||
非線性結(jié)構(gòu),樹與二叉樹,LINUX內(nèi)核紅黑樹 |
|||
查找與排序,散列存儲(chǔ),LINUX哈希表 |
|||
階段綜合項(xiàng)目(航班查詢系統(tǒng)) |
|||
3天 |
標(biāo)準(zhǔn)IO編程 |
LINUX-IO編程精髓 |
18天 |
系統(tǒng)IO編程 |
|||
文件與目錄操作,庫文件制作與使用 |
|||
|
第1期考試 |
筆試、閉卷 |
|
第二期(16天)
課時(shí) |
課程內(nèi)容 |
備注 |
課時(shí)累計(jì) |
||
6天 |
LINUX多進(jìn)程核心概念,多進(jìn)程API |
LINUX系統(tǒng)編程 |
24天 |
||
LINUX精靈進(jìn)程編寫技術(shù),進(jìn)程間管道通信機(jī)制 |
|||||
LINUX異步信號(hào)進(jìn)程間通信技術(shù) |
|||||
LINUX系統(tǒng)編程之SystemV IPC |
|||||
LINUX多線程編程核心技術(shù),線程池機(jī)制 |
|||||
階段綜合項(xiàng)目(多線程并發(fā)文件拷貝) |
|||||
5天 |
網(wǎng)絡(luò)編程核心概念,TCP/UDP編程API |
LINUX網(wǎng)絡(luò)編程核心技術(shù) |
29天 |
||
TCP/UDP各種IO編程模型,高級(jí)套接字編程技術(shù) |
|||||
TCP/IP**棧分析,廣播與組播,帶外數(shù)據(jù)等 |
|||||
階段綜合項(xiàng)目(飛鴿傳書) |
|||||
階段綜合項(xiàng)目(飛鴿傳書) |
|||||
5天 |
面向?qū)ο缶幊踢M(jìn)階 |
JAVA編程 |
UI編程 |
34天 |
|
JAVA核心API函數(shù) |
|||||
安卓相關(guān)JAVA技術(shù)點(diǎn) |
|||||
Android主要組件 |
安卓核心技術(shù) |
||||
Android常用圖形界面組件 |
|||||
Android事件處理 |
|||||
階段綜合項(xiàng)目(Android平臺(tái)音樂播放器) |
|||||
|
第2期考試 |
筆試,閉卷 |
|
第三期(26天)
課時(shí) |
課程內(nèi)容 |
備注 |
課時(shí)累計(jì) |
1天 |
數(shù)字電路基礎(chǔ) 如何看原理圖 |
數(shù)字電路基礎(chǔ) |
35天 |
10天 |
GEC2440硬件開發(fā)平臺(tái)搭建 bootloader燒寫、內(nèi)核和文件系統(tǒng)燒寫 |
ARM編程核心技術(shù) |
** |
ARM核心概念介紹 ARM匯編入門與提高、C與匯編混合編程 |
|||
MDK開發(fā)環(huán)境使用、JLink仿真器使用 ARM開5發(fā)調(diào)試環(huán)境建立、ARM GPIO應(yīng)用 ARM中斷模式IRQ和FIQ、ARM工作模式轉(zhuǎn)換 |
|||
ARM時(shí)鐘與定時(shí)器 TFT LCD驅(qū)動(dòng)程序設(shè)計(jì)、看門狗設(shè)置于應(yīng)用 LCD顯示曲線和圖片 |
|||
ARM存儲(chǔ)器控制器MMU原理、串口通信 |
|||
NOR flash、NAND flash應(yīng)用設(shè)計(jì) I2C(念:I方C)總線控制 |
|||
ADC控制器設(shè)置與應(yīng)用:觸摸屏應(yīng)用及校準(zhǔn) |
|||
PWM時(shí)鐘設(shè)置與應(yīng)用:實(shí)時(shí)時(shí)鐘及鬧鐘應(yīng)用 ARM啟動(dòng)代碼設(shè)計(jì)、蜂鳴器控制 |
|||
2天 |
210開發(fā)板介紹 相關(guān)寄存器介紹 Cortex-A8相關(guān)硬件接口介紹 |
210開發(fā)板過渡課程 |
47天 |
|
第3期期中考試 |
閉卷,筆試 |
|
7天 |
制作根文件系統(tǒng) |
LINUX系統(tǒng)開發(fā) |
54天 |
制作嵌入式文件系統(tǒng) |
|||
ARM 匯編高階:GNU語法擴(kuò)展 |
|||
bootloader分析 |
|||
bootloader設(shè)計(jì) |
|||
10天 |
LINUX的內(nèi)存管理 LINUX的任務(wù)管理 |
嵌入式LINUX驅(qū)動(dòng) |
64天 |
LINUX字符設(shè)備概述 字符設(shè)備驅(qū)動(dòng)編寫 字符設(shè)備驅(qū)動(dòng)的測(cè)試程序 |
|||
LINUX中斷上下部處理函數(shù) LINUX并發(fā)控制方法 LINUX阻塞與非阻塞 LINU定時(shí)器 |
|||
LINUX驅(qū)動(dòng)中斷 LINUX并發(fā)控制 |
|||
LINUX設(shè)備內(nèi)存申請(qǐng)與操作方法 設(shè)備非阻塞pool實(shí)現(xiàn) Sync異步通信方式 Ioctl設(shè)備控制方法 |
|||
LINUX設(shè)備模型概述 平臺(tái)總線模型 Struct class的使用 |
|||
階段綜合項(xiàng)目(DHT11驅(qū)動(dòng)編寫) |
|||
LCD種類和性能介紹 設(shè)計(jì)S3C2440 LCD裸機(jī)程序 理解LINUX內(nèi)核framebuffer的機(jī)制及編程方法 |
|||
觸摸屏原理 ADC裸機(jī)編程 LINUX輸入子系統(tǒng)框架下的驅(qū)動(dòng)編程 |
|||
塊設(shè)備概述 塊設(shè)備驅(qū)動(dòng)的框架 塊設(shè)備驅(qū)動(dòng)涉及的關(guān)鍵結(jié)構(gòu)體 塊設(shè)備驅(qū)動(dòng)涉及的關(guān)鍵函數(shù) |
|||
網(wǎng)絡(luò)設(shè)備概述 網(wǎng)絡(luò)設(shè)備驅(qū)動(dòng)的框架 網(wǎng)絡(luò)設(shè)備驅(qū)動(dòng)涉及的關(guān)鍵結(jié)構(gòu)體 網(wǎng)絡(luò)設(shè)備驅(qū)動(dòng)涉及的關(guān)鍵函數(shù) |
|||
內(nèi)核調(diào)試的概念和特點(diǎn) 內(nèi)核調(diào)試的工具 內(nèi)核調(diào)試注意事項(xiàng) 內(nèi)核的優(yōu)化 |
|||
|
第3期期末考試 |
考試形式待定 |
|
第四期(20天)
課時(shí) |
課程內(nèi)容 |
備注 |
課時(shí)累計(jì) |
7天 |
智能小區(qū)綜合項(xiàng)目架構(gòu) |
|
|
智能小區(qū)系統(tǒng)設(shè)計(jì)方案分析 |
|||
智能小區(qū)概要設(shè)計(jì) |
|||
智能小區(qū)概要設(shè)計(jì)評(píng)審 |
|||
項(xiàng)目接口設(shè)計(jì) |
SD卡驅(qū)動(dòng) flash驅(qū)動(dòng) |
||
項(xiàng)目接口設(shè)計(jì) |
|||
智能小區(qū)詳細(xì)設(shè)計(jì)評(píng)審 |
|||
10天 |
項(xiàng)目編碼設(shè)計(jì)指導(dǎo) |
||
項(xiàng)目編碼設(shè)計(jì)指導(dǎo) |
USB驅(qū)動(dòng) SPI驅(qū)動(dòng) |
||
項(xiàng)目編碼設(shè)計(jì)指導(dǎo) |
|||
項(xiàng)目編碼設(shè)計(jì)指導(dǎo) |
|||
項(xiàng)目編碼設(shè)計(jì)指導(dǎo) |
|||
項(xiàng)目編碼設(shè)計(jì)指導(dǎo) |
|||
項(xiàng)目編碼設(shè)計(jì)指導(dǎo) |
攝像頭驅(qū)動(dòng) 音頻驅(qū)動(dòng) |
||
84天 |
|||
項(xiàng)目編碼設(shè)計(jì)指導(dǎo) |
|||
項(xiàng)目編碼設(shè)計(jì)指導(dǎo) |
|||
3天 |
項(xiàng)目整合測(cè)試 |
|
|
項(xiàng)目整合測(cè)試 |
|
||
項(xiàng)目答辯 |
說明:總課時(shí)84天(不含預(yù)科) |
說明:總課時(shí)84天(不含預(yù)科)
第1期(LINUX基礎(chǔ),C語言,數(shù)據(jù)結(jié)構(gòu),文件IO):18天
第2期(系統(tǒng)編程,網(wǎng)絡(luò)編程,JAVA進(jìn)階及安卓應(yīng)用):16天
第3期(ARM編程,LINUX系統(tǒng)開發(fā),LINUX驅(qū)動(dòng)):30天
第4期(項(xiàng)目):20天
學(xué)員作品
明星
校園環(huán)境
>>>>前50名電話咨詢的學(xué)員即可獲得三天免費(fèi)試聽機(jī)會(huì),名額有限,快快行動(dòng)吧!
更多課程查看>>>>>
新信息
廣州嵌入式相關(guān)搜索:
廣州嵌入式培訓(xùn)機(jī)構(gòu):
>>>>>
倒計(jì)時(shí)
更多詳情請(qǐng)咨詢客服
客服在線時(shí)間:9:00-22:00,其他時(shí)間請(qǐng)?jiān)诰€預(yù)約或留言,謝謝。廣州信盈達(dá)嵌入式學(xué)院:廣州天河區(qū)棠東東路御富科貿(mào)園
本周僅剩 個(gè)試聽名額
請(qǐng)鍵入信息,稍后系統(tǒng)將會(huì)把領(lǐng)獎(jiǎng)短信發(fā)至您的手機(jī)